I have never been very good at writing about me. I can write about the world, but writing about me is a challenge. However, I will give it a shot...
I do my best to be a good person, to treat people with love and respect. I am dedicated to the idea of socially conscious living and business, to building strong community, a community of people living and working together in harmony, utilizing each individuals talents in order to raise up as community with a united voice and a united vision. We each have a piece of the puzzle and my hope is to help create a forum in which we can come together and actualize our dreams.
Much of my time is spent working to find ways bring people together, whether through events, online forums, meetings, dinners, interests, etc. I also love music and have always worked to organize events. Lately my career has been refocused to community organizing but events play a big role.
I look around at a world, a world that lately seems to be falling apart at the seams, and I see hope. I see a wave of consciousness that is empowering a movement of people that is paving the next great chapter of life on this planet, and I am working to find my place in the foundation of that movement. I know that when people come together great things can happen… and while this older paradigm of living is failing. I see something new being born. There is a great opportunity that needs to be utilized. Nothing can stand in the way of a million voices calling for change. So I guess it is hard for me to write about me, because I am only a small part of the truth that we are all one, and what we do and accomplish together is what truly interests me.
My passion is my spirituality....shamanism, qigong... and energy work. Everything comes back to my path... to teach and be taught... to exsist always... learning and always sharing... always the path...
Favorite Quotes....
"Until one is committed, there is hesitancy, the chance to draw back-- Concerning all acts of initiative (and creation), there is one elementary truth that ignorance of which kills countless ideas and splendid plans: that the moment one definitely commits oneself, then Providence moves too. All sorts of things occur to help one that would never otherwise have occurred. A whole stream of events issues from the decision, raising in one's favor all manner of unforeseen incidents and meetings and material assistance, which no man could have dreamed would have come his way. Whatever you can do, or dream you can do, begin it. Boldness has genius, power, and magic in it. Begin it now." -Goethe
"This process of listening to our own desires and acting to fulfill them is fundamental to building an identity. We come into this world with a self, but it is more a potential than a fully developed identity. We learn about who we are by what we want, what we do, and what we think and feel. The happiest people always are the ones who risk enough to be fully themselves. They are the ones who play the pre scribed roles the least, but they also have no particular need to be rebels either. They not only have the strongest sense of who they are, they also can receive and give more love than other people because they have confidence that the love that comes their way is real, and not just a response to the roles they play. " --from The Hero Within, Carol S. Pearson
